Progressive Web Application, aka PWA, is the best way to enable developers to install web applications faster and more efficiently. In short, PWAs are websites that use the latest web standards to allow the user to be installed on their computer or device. It gives users an app-like experience.
Before we move forward, let me briefly describe PWAs.
PWA is a web application that can be installed on your system. It works offline when there is no Internet connection and uses cached data during your recent interactions with the app.
PWAs, which we see as responsive websites, take the user's browser features. Native can automatically improve built-in features to look like a web application.
What is the difference between PWAs and Native Apps?
The NAtive application is an independent program that works on a smartphone. It works like a program on your computer that you run like Microsoft Word.
PWA is websites that appear as mobile apps. PWAs are more similar to Google Docs because they can perform the same functions as local programs, but through an internet browser.
Here are a few more differences between PWAs and native apps, let's take a look at them!
One of the best things about PWAs is that native applications don't have restrictions that restrict the ability to work with only one platform. This means that PWAs should be as open to development as possible and work on as many platforms as possible. PWAs work with any browser that the user owns.
Inaniably, users access the internet via mobile phones, tablets, desktopcomputers, laptops and various other devices.
As a PWA is made public, PWA assumes that anyone using PWA will do it from the desktop. Responsive design is the design in which a website is set to meet the requirements of the device used in its design.
Responsive design makes PWAs progressive and accessible on a variety of devices.
No matter how far PWA goes beyond traditional applications, it is important to point out that they still need to maintain native application-like structure. It is one of the biggest differences between a PWA and a website. There are many websites with several simple pages that contain static pages such as contact information, blog articles, and sales pages. To be accepted as a PWA, a website must contain interactive features that concern the user.
Why Do We Need a Web Application?
PWAs help solve problems such as internet speed, slow website load, and user interaction. There are reasons to use a progressive web application to overcome these problems, but these are some of the best features because they provide:
- Fast: PWAs provide a continuously fast experience for users. Everything happens extremely quickly from the moment the user downloads the app and starts interacting.
- Integrated User Experience: With PWAs, experience integration is seamless. This is because the user can send instant notifications to the home screen and access the device's functions such as native apps.
Advantages of PWAs
Without sacrificing performance or security, PWAs provide the application experience as users want. One of the biggest issues for the Internet is security, especially when it comes to stolen, shared, or hacked content. PWAs can tackle this problem.
2. Easy Updates
Application updates are most necessary when it comes to internet use. For improvements, new features have been improved by fixing errors and glitches. PWAs added the benefits of sending updates to developers, not by users. New updates and features can be added remotely by the development team. Users will notice new and improved features, but they don't have to download updates themselves.
3. Access from Anywhere
Apps come with disadvantages that need to be regularly migrated to the new version, may be too large to install, or may not be compatible with specific devices. There are a number of factors that make it difficult to install and use. The benefits of PWAs come here. This is because the application is presented as an interactive website and is especially available to anyone with internet access and browser.